  1. 1
    Weekly Quick Scans: Set a reminder to run a scan every Sunday. Most infections are caught within the first week, so regular checks give you peace of mind.
  2. 2
    Update Everything: Those annoying update popups exist for a reason — they patch security holes. Windows, browsers, Adobe, Java — keep them all current.
  3. 3
    Download Smart: Stick to official websites and app stores. If a "free" version of paid software sounds too good to be true, it probably comes with unwanted extras.
  4. 4
    Think Before You Click: Malware loves email attachments and "urgent" links. Even if an email looks like it's from your bank or a friend, verify suspicious requests through a different channel.
